Grant Writer/Project Associate

Remote Full-time
Healthy Communities Consulting is seeking a Grant Writer/Project Associate to join our team. The position will be responsible for grant writing, budget development, project coordination, administrative support, and data research. Must be organized, resourceful, and able to manage multiple projects. Requires at least 2 years’ experience working with or for health and human service non-profits, preferably in grant writing/development work. Healthy Communities Consulting is a boutique consulting firm specializing in grant writing and related services for non-profit health and human service agencies across the US. Our services include grant writing, grant prospecting, program development, budget development, grant submissions, grants management, research, evaluation plan development, evaluation and quality assurance, and strategic planning. Responsibilities • Grant writing/support: This will include working closely with Healthy Communities Consulting’s Principals to prepare narrative drafts, including identifying required information, conducting research and compiling data, and writing narrative • Budget development/budget justifications: development of program budgets, budget justifications, and other grant-related attachments • Grants.gov and other online forms/submissions: Will include assisting in submission procedures for grant applications • Data research: Compiling and incorporating updated data for grant applications, includes researching government and other websites for most recent data to analyze and include in grant applications • RFA/NOFO analyses for clients: Compiling and communicating all requirements for specific funding opportunities, including eligibility, allowable/unallowable costs, attachment requirements, due dates, registration timelines, etc. Qualifications • Bachelor’s degree and at least 2 years’ experience working with or for health and human service non-profits, preferably in grant writing/development work • Ability to research and apply analytical skills to support program development • Ability to prioritize multiple demands, work independently, and meet deadlines • Strong coordination, organizational and communication skills, writing background a plus • Understanding of social determinants of health and issues facing marginalized populations (e.g., homelessness, HIV/AIDS, substance use, and mental illness, among others) Apply tot his job
